Bug Description
During the install process, the installer attempted and reported success in
finding a DHCP server when there was no DHCP server on the network. It was very
easy to reconfigure using a static IP after the install, but I would expect the
installer to fail and allow me to configure those settings manually before
proceeding.
I have an nforce2 based motherboard with a built in ethernet device. I'm not
sure which module it uses.
